Transaction ec937883d34566ce28fc09a33e3554bad8db981b9b3317d3c9b25a3a6b49d994
1 Input
1 Output
-
ec937883d34566ce28fc09a33e3554bad8db981b9b3317d3c9b25a3a6b49d994:0
- value
- 499997266
- script pubkey
- OP_0 OP_PUSHBYTES_20 70a643acf6e071d150050c10b5269e280309fcd6
- address
- bc1qwzny8t8kupcaz5q9psgt2f579qpsnlxksxuxnd